Last-resort Investigator
A former forensic ace and a psychology expert use science and lie detection to uncover truths behind impossible cases.
Sources loading...
Select a source above to start watching.
A former forensic ace and a psychology expert use science and lie detection to uncover truths behind impossible cases.
Select a source above to start watching.